Understanding Optical Fibre Testing



Optical fiber testing is a vital process in telecoms that guarantees the honesty and efficiency of fibre optic networks. This screening includes a variety of treatments made to evaluate the physical and practical features of optical fibers - optical fibre diameter analyser. Trick parameters analyzed consist of optical power loss, bandwidth ability, and mistake location, which are necessary for keeping high-grade interaction links


The testing process generally includes using customized equipment such as Optical Time-Domain Reflectometers (OTDR) and Optical Power Meters. OTDRs are utilized to recognize and define faults, interlaces, and ports within the fiber, while power meters gauge the transmitted light signal strength to determine efficiency.


Moreover, screening is carried out at numerous phases, consisting of throughout installation, maintenance, and troubleshooting, to guarantee that the network fulfills industry standards and functional demands. Compliance with requirements set by companies like the International Telecommunication Union (ITU) and the Telecoms Market Association (TIA) is extremely important.

Usual Checking Techniques



Testing optical fibres utilizes various approaches to make sure the stability and efficiency of telecommunications networks. Among the most typical methods is Optical Time Domain Name Reflectometry (OTDR), which analyzes the whole length of the fiber by sending out a pulse of light and measuring the reflections triggered by blemishes or breaks. This technique provides in-depth information concerning the area and intensity of faults.


Another common method is using Optical Power Meters, which gauge the amount of light sent via the fiber. This strategy helps identify the loss of signal toughness, making certain that it satisfies market criteria. In Addition, Aesthetic Fault Locators (VFL) are employed to recognize breaks or serious bends in the straight from the source fiber by predicting a visible laser light right into the wire.


Insertion loss testing is additionally important, as it quantifies the loss of signal power resulting from connections and splices within the network. The use of Polarization Mode Diffusion (PMD) screening examines the influence of fiber features on signal honesty.


Each of these techniques plays an essential function in maintaining the performance and dependability of optical fiber networks, ultimately adding to smooth telecoms operations.
